Indore hosted India and Bangladesh in the First Test and the supremacy of the Virat Kohli-led Indian team was evident once again as they registered a crushing win by an innings & 130 runs inside three days on Saturday (November 16).

Bangladesh won the toss and surprisingly opted to bat first on a pitch that had some moisture and help for the fast bowlers, which Indian bowlers exploited as the visitors were blown away for just 150 runs with Mushfiqur Rahim top scoring with 43 runs.

India in reply, declared their first innings at 493/6 in just 114 overs with Mayank Agarwal scoring a career-best 243, while Ajinkya Rahane (86), Ravindra Jadeja (60*) and Cheteshwar Pujara (54) scored half-centuries.

Bangladesh trailing by 343 runs, failed to put up a strong resistance as they were bowled out for 213 and lost the Test by an innings after Tea on Day 3. Rahim again was the highest scorer for Bangladesh with 64. 14 of the wickets in the match were picked up by Indian fast bowlers, with Mohammad Shami picking up 7/58.

Rahim's match could have looked much different had the Indian fielders held their catches, as he was dropped twice in both innings. To his credit, he battled hard and delayed the inevitable else the margin of defeat could have been bigger.

Indian cricket fans and Rahim go back a long way, as Rahim has often batted well against India. He has two Test centuries to his name against the Asian giants, and recently played a key role in Bangladesh's first-ever T20I win over India in India.

Rahim had also famously tweeted after India lost the T20 World Cup semi-final in 2016, which has never been forgotten by the fans.

Rahim is a wicket-keeper, but is playing as a specialist batsman in the Test series as Liton Das is keeping wickets. While he was fielding on the boundary in Indore, some fans decided to roast him by chanting "Do rupay ki Pepsi, Rahim bhai sexy".
